All The Places You Can Put Your Photos

Have any of you seen the birthday cakes that they put pictures on? If you bring a picture to the right supermarket or specialty bakery, they will use different colors of frosting to “print” the picture onto the top of the cake. I have no idea how it actually happens, but I still find the process rather fascinating.

I was at a wedding about a year ago where the bride and groom did this. First they had a professional photographer take a couple different portraits of them before the wedding. Then they chose their favorite one and had it printed on the top layer (only two layers) of the cake. It made for a lively discussion during the reception and overall was a hit. And no, the groom did not put any cake in the bride’s face, that would just be weird.

Speaking of photos though, another great place to include a picture is somewhere in the wedding invitation. This couple decided the best way to invite people to share in their love was to include photos in their save the date card that expressed how they felt about each other.

Personalizing Your Letterpress Wedding Invitations Photo

While thinking about your letterpress wedding invitations, why not include a special photo of you and your betrothed? It can add an extra special vibe to your invitation set.
